cdef extern from "" namespace "std" nogil: cdef cppclass vector[T,ALLOCATOR=*]: ctypedef T value_type ctypedef ALLOCATOR allocator_type # these should really be allocator_type.size_type and # allocator_type.difference_type to be true to the C++ definition # but cython doesn't support deferred access on template arguments ctypedef size_t size_type ctypedef ptrdiff_t difference_type cppclass iterator: T& operator*() iterator operator++() iterator operator--() iterator operator+(size_type) iterator operator-(size_type) difference_type operator-(iterator) bint operator==(iterator) bint operator!=(iterator) bint operator<(iterator) bint operator>(iterator) bint operator<=(iterator) bint operator>=(iterator) cppclass reverse_iterator: T& operator*() reverse_iterator operator++() reverse_iterator operator--() reverse_iterator operator+(size_type) reverse_iterator operator-(size_type) difference_type operator-(reverse_iterator) bint operator==(reverse_iterator) bint operator!=(reverse_iterator) bint operator<(reverse_iterator) bint operator>(reverse_iterator) bint operator<=(reverse_iterator) bint operator>=(reverse_iterator) cppclass const_iterator(iterator): pass cppclass const_reverse_iterator(reverse_iterator): pass vector() except + vector(vector&) except + vector(size_type) except + vector(size_type, T&) except + #vector[input_iterator](input_iterator, input_iterator) T& operator[](size_type) #vector& operator=(vector&) bint operator==(vector&, vector&) bint operator!=(vector&, vector&) bint operator<(vector&, vector&) bint operator>(vector&, vector&) bint operator<=(vector&, vector&) bint operator>=(vector&, vector&) void assign(size_type, const T&) void assign[input_iterator](input_iterator, input_iterator) except + T& at(size_type) except + T& back() iterator begin() const_iterator const_begin "begin"() size_type capacity() void clear() bint empty() iterator end() const_iterator const_end "end"() iterator erase(iterator) iterator erase(iterator, iterator) T& front() iterator insert(iterator, const T&) except + iterator insert(iterator, size_type, const T&) except + iterator insert[Iter](iterator, Iter, Iter) except + size_type max_size() void pop_back() void push_back(T&) except + reverse_iterator rbegin() const_reverse_iterator const_rbegin "crbegin"() reverse_iterator rend() const_reverse_iterator const_rend "crend"() void reserve(size_type) void resize(size_type) except + void resize(size_type, T&) except + size_type size() void swap(vector&) # C++11 methods T* data() const T* const_data "data"() void shrink_to_fit()
